Jewelry-grade Bio-epoxy

A highly specialized, sustainable, eco-friendly alternative to traditional petroleum-based resins. Formulated with plant-based, bio-derived and waste-stream materials, it contains more than 30% renewable content. Material sources include soy, pine, or cashew nut shell liquids. Jewelry-grade bio-epoxy offers high clarity, low toxicity, and excellent durability, making it a preferred choice for crafting sustainable heritage quality art, while reducing reliance on petroleum-based products. VOC free. Crystal-clear finish with a high-gloss, glass-like sheen. Superior non-yellowing (UV resistant) properties, tensile strength, adhesive properties, and impact resistance, compared to traditional petroleum-based epoxies. Includes HALS (Hindered Amine Light Stabilizers) to prevent yellowing. Waterproof.

Sterling Silver

.925 sterling silver is a durable, high-quality alloy consisting of 92.5% pure silver and 7.5% copper. This offers a brilliant white metal luster, while gaining hardness. Pure silver is too soft to maintain form easily without copper.
In folklore silver is associated with warding off evil and supernatural creatures.
In many cultures it's historically used as a token of good luck, prosperity, healing, or protection.

Banded Agate

Named after the Aches River (now the Drillo) in Sicily, when discovered by ancient Greeks. Known as “Earth Rainbow” believed to protect against lightning, quench thirst and guard against evil spirits. A microcrystalline quartz (chalcedony) characterized by distinct; often concentric bands/stripes of varying colors and textures. Formed in voids of volcanic rock, with layers built over time by silica-rich water. A trigonal cryptocrystalline quartz with vitreous to waxy luster. Roman scholars prized it for healing and in many traditions it was used to ensure victory in battle and to protect travelers.
